In this presentation, Craig Turner (Manager of Client Relations for the Queensland Rural and Industry Development Authority – QRIDA) discusses the loans and grants available to primary producers to recover from the North and Far North Queensland monsoonal trough flooding event (25/1/2019 – 14/2/2019).

Craig outlines and provides details on:

• The disaster assistance available to primary producers,
• Business eligibility to apply,
• What is the application process, and
• Other assistance loans available to primary producers.

Further assistance:

  • For any questions about QRIDA grants and loans relating to this flood event please call 1800 623 946.  Or you can find further information here at Disaster Recovery on the QRIDA website.
  • For any other questions relating to this flood event please call the DAF Call Centre on 13 25 23, and they will put you in touch with the best person to answer your enquiry.
